Analysis

Switzerland recorded 68.8% for share of male vs. female employment in services in 2025. That is the highest value across all 35 years on record.

That represents a change of up 0.5% on the previous year and up 4.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, share of male vs. female employment in services in Switzerland peaked at 68.8% in 2025 and was at its lowest, 59.9%, in 1995.

That places Switzerland 28th out of 186 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 35 years of available data.
